It is extremely useful for the students taking a course on Numerical Analysis, as it will help them to compare and analyse the data given in their text-books.

It will also serve as an helping hand for classroom lectures, as students and instructors can verify their results right away, without needing to write their own algorithms, or buying expensive softwares like MATLAB.

I have taken utmost care to make sure that the algorithms used are stable, and consistent. A lot of equations and data was used to test the app and the results were compared with all the leading softwares available. The results were in very satisfactory.

However, I still encourage users to report any bug or strange crash.
Numerical Methods Calculators- contains the following tools and calculators:

Matrix Operations:
->Addition/Subtraction of Matrices
-> Multiplication of Matrices
-> (P)LU Decomposition
-> Rank
-> Row Echelon Form
-> Trace
-> Determinant
-> Transpose

Numerical Integration:
-> Trapezoidal Method
-> Simpson’s 1/3 Rule
-> Simpson’s 3/8 Rule

Curve Fitting(using least squares)
-> Linear Fitting
-> Exponential Fitting
-> Polynomial Fitting

Root Finding:
-> Bisection Method
-> Secant Method
-> Newton-Raphson Method
